HC Deb 26 March 1970 vol 798 cc503-4W
Mr. Gwynfor Evans

asked the Chancellor of the Exchequer what is his estimate of the effect of reducing the road fund licence by £15 in Pembroke- shire, Carmarthenshire, Cardiganshire, Merionethshire and Caernarvonshire, respectively.

Mr. Taverne

If the annual rate of duty for private cars were reduced by £15, it is estimated that the net loss of revenue would be as follows:

£ per annum
Pembrokeshire 370,000
Carmarthenshire 555,000
Cardiganshire 215,000
Merionethshire 135,000
Caernarvonshire 410,000
Total 1,685,000
